Level 60 Hunter Spreadsheet (using Lactose’s cycle formulae)
(September 19, 2006)

Hey guys, here is a spreadsheet I made to help compare specs and armor sets for survival and marksmanship hunters to compare raid damage. Most of the spreadsheets I have seen were too complicated or didn't work correctly so I tried to make this simple. Tell me what you guys think. This is still a work in progress, any ideas, fixes or help would be appreciated.

Level 60 Hunter Spreadsheet: Version 3.2
Quickdump
Filefront

Burning Crusade Spreadsheet: Version 3.2 Alpha
Quickdump
Filefront

Spreadsheet includes:
Full and clipped cycle damage comparisons using Lactose’s formulae
Un-buffed, self-buffed and raid-buffed statistics
Two sets of talents and armor sets to compare with
Drop down armor menus and selectable buffs
Average and maximum burst damage for PvP
Mana longevity (Spirit not included, sorry T_T)
Damage per mana ratio
And a few other goodies…!

Horde raid buffs:
Warchief's Blessing - http://www.thottbot.com/?sp=16609

Horde party buffs:
Grace of Air (Rank 1) - +43 Agi
Grace of Air (Rank 2) - +67 Agi
Grace of Air (Rank 3) - +77 Agi

Strength of Earth (Rank 1) - +10 Str
Strength of Earth (Rank 2) - +20 Str
Strength of Earth (Rank 3) - +36 Str
Strength of Earth (Rank 4) - +61 Str
Strength of Earth (Rank 5) - +77 Str

Enhancing Totems [Tier 3 Enhancement Talent]
(1/2) - Increases the effect of your Strength of Earth and Grace of Air Totems by 8%
(2/2) - Increases the effect of your Strength of Earth and Grace of Air Totems by 15%
